Transaction 5337078f01403473b5a9a71a9379525edce70445b9dc3e36a9e27f1aac693b43
1 Input
1 Output
-
5337078f01403473b5a9a71a9379525edce70445b9dc3e36a9e27f1aac693b43:0
- value
- 11068390625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1deb60e51c79c7b50b65a11dd151197cd699a3ba OP_EQUAL
- address
- MAdMoNsSo69YusqD4pEKg2zBNDe9KEvycN